[SHABELLENEWS] The Federal government of Somalia has issued a new measures to prevent Al shabaab from collecting tax funds, to finance its insurgency against the AU and National Army forces.
The announcement was made at a presser in Mogadishu Saturday by Somalia’s Minster of security Mohammed Abukar Dualle, along with Police and Intelligence chiefs.
The chief of the Intelligence & security agency (NISA) Abdullahi Mohammed Ali Sanbalolshe said the government banned businesses from providing financial support for Al shabaab.
"We will hold accountable and confiscate every business center, large or small that provide tax to Al shabaab. The government will not tolerate funding the group," said Dualle.
This is the first warning by the Somali Federal government since it took power in last January, and it is not clear how and when it will come into effect.

[Rooters] The number of asylum seekers walking across the U.S. border into Canada rose in June after dropping in the previous two months, according to government figures released on Friday.
There were 884 refugee claimants who crossed the border between formal crossings and were picked up by Royal Canadian Mounted Police last month, bringing the total for the first half of 2017 to 4,345, the data showed.
The vast majority, 88 percent, of June's crossers went to the province of Quebec, a marked contrast from previous months where upwards of 100 a month went to the prairie province of Manitoba.

Baghdad (IraqiNews.com) The town of Tal Afar, west of Mosul, will most likely be the next target for U.S.-backed Iraqi forces seeking to eliminate Islamic State militants from the country, a spokesperson of the U.S.-led coalition against IS.
Col. Ryan Dillon was quoted by Kurdistan-based website Xendan saying that the IS stronghold will be the next target of operations after the Iraqi government declared earlier this month victory over the militant group in Mosul, its largest bastion in Iraq.
Dillon said the coalition continues to pound IS locations on the outskirts of Kirkuk, another province partially held by the militants, as well as Anbar’s Qaim, on the borders with Syria.
Conflicting speculations concerning the next target have surfaced since victory was declared in Mosul.
Besides Tal Afar, IS still holds some areas in southwestern Kirkuk, western Anbar and areas on the borders between Diyala and Salahuddin.
So far, operations by pro-government militias have isolated Tal Afar from the Syrian borders and from Mosul.
On Sunday, Almaalomah website quoted Nineveh council member, Hossam al-Abbar, saying that Tal Afar was the source of most of the recent breaches by IS militants that targeted western Mosul.
Conflicting statements have been frequent regarding the participation of the Shia-led, government-recognized Popular Mobilization Forces (PMF) in the liberation of Tal Afar, a town of a mixed Shia Arab and Sunni Turkmen population. Sunni Turkey has pressed Baghdad to exclude the PMFs from the anticipated campaign fearing sectarian twists. PMF leaders have, meanwhile, said occasionally that the government was going to engage them in the battle.

[AlMasdar] A new de-escalation zone agreement was announced yesterday in regards to the East Ghouta pocket. The arrangement was signed-off by the Russian military and Syrian opposition representatives in Cairo.
The Syrian Arab Army (SAA) also announced that they signed the agreement and will stop all operations in certain parts of East Ghouta starting from today at 12:00 P.M., but nonetheless warned that it would retaliate to any breach of the ceasefire.
The Jaysh Al-Islam militant coalition (the largest rebel faction in the East Ghouta pocket) announced that they signed the de-escalation zone agreement with the hope that it will lead to the end of siege conditions via the entering of food, fuel and other aid into the area, optimistically adding that such actions will lead to a political solution for the Syrian crisis.
It is worth noting that a Syrian military source added that areas of East Ghouta held by the Faylaq al-Rahman Islamist faction and Ha’yat Tahrir al-Sham (HTS) jihadist group are not included in the de-escalation proposal as neither agreed to it and to this end operations against them by pro-government forces will continue.
